Linaro build process fails to generate builds for 20100919 and 20100920

Bug #643462 reported by Torez Smith
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
linux-linaro (Ubuntu)
Fix Released
High
John Rigby

Bug Description

Build log shows failure while building /build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ools/perf

install -d /build/buildd/linux-linaro-2.6.35/debian/build/tools-
for i in *; do ln -s /build/buildd/linux-linaro-2.6.35/$i /build/buildd/linux-linaro-2.6.35/debian/build/tools-/; done
rm /build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ools
rsync -a tools/ /build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ools/
touch /build/buildd/linux-linaro-2.6.35/debian/stamps/stamp-prepare-perarch
cd /build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ools/perf && make
make[1]: Entering directory `/build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ools/perf'
Makefile:565: newt not found, disables TUI support. Please install newt-devel or libnewt-dev
PERF_VERSION = 2.6.35.4
make[1]: Leaving directory `/build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ools/perf'
make[1]: Entering directory `/build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ools/perf'
Makefile:565: newt not found, disables TUI support. Please install newt-devel or libnewt-dev
    GEN common-cmds.h
    * new build flags or prefix
    CC perf.o
    CC builtin-annotate.o
    CC builtin-bench.o
    CC bench/sched-messaging.o
    CC bench/sched-pipe.o
    CC bench/mem-memcpy.o
    CC builtin-diff.o
    CC builtin-help.o
    CC builtin-sched.o
    CC builtin-buildid-list.o
    CC builtin-buildid-cache.o
    CC builtin-list.o
    CC builtin-record.o
    CC builtin-report.o
    CC builtin-stat.o
    CC builtin-timechart.o
    CC builtin-top.o
    CC builtin-trace.o
    CC builtin-probe.o
    CC builtin-kmem.o
    CC builtin-lock.o
    CC builtin-kvm.o
    CC builtin-test.o
    CC builtin-inject.o
    CC util/abspath.o
    CC util/alias.o
    CC util/build-id.o
    CC util/config.o
    CC util/ctype.o
    CC util/debugfs.o
    CC util/environment.o
    CC util/event.o
    CC util/exec_cmd.o
    CC util/help.o
    CC util/levenshtein.o
    CC util/parse-options.o
    CC util/parse-events.o
    CC util/path.o
    CC util/rbtree.o
    CC util/bitmap.o
    CC util/hweight.o
    CC util/run-command.o
    CC util/quote.o
    CC util/strbuf.o
    CC util/string.o
    CC util/strlist.o
    CC util/usage.o
    CC util/wrapper.o
    CC util/sigchain.o
    CC util/symbol.o
    CC util/color.o
    CC util/pager.o
    CC util/header.o
    CC util/callchain.o
    CC util/values.o
    CC util/debug.o
    CC util/map.o
    CC util/pstack.o
    CC util/session.o
    CC util/thread.o
    CC util/trace-event-parse.o
    CC util/trace-event-read.o
    CC util/trace-event-info.o
    CC util/trace-event-scripting.o
    CC util/svghelper.o
    CC util/sort.o
    CC util/hist.o
    CC util/probe-event.o
    CC util/util.o
    CC util/cpumap.o
    CC arch/arm/util/dwarf-regs.o
    CC util/probe-finder.o
    AR libperf.a
    LINK perf
    GEN perf-archive
touch .perf.dev.null
rm .perf.dev.null
make[1]: Leaving directory `/build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ools/perf'
# Add the tools.
install -d /build/buildd/linux-linaro-2.6.35/debian/linux-linaro-tools-2.6.35-1006/usr/bin
install -s -m755 /build/buildd/linux-linaro-2.6.35/debian/build/tools-/tools/perf/perf \
  /build/buildd/linux-linaro-2.6.35/debian/linux-linaro-tools-2.6.35-1006/usr/bin/perf_2.6.35-1006
dh_installchangelogs -plinux-linaro-tools-2.6.35-1006
dh_installchangelogs: package linux-linaro-tools-2.6.35-1006 is not in control info
dh_installdocs -plinux-linaro-tools-2.6.35-1006
dh_installdocs: package linux-linaro-tools-2.6.35-1006 is not in control info
dh_compress -plinux-linaro-tools-2.6.35-1006
dh_fixperms -plinux-linaro-tools-2.6.35-1006
dh_shlibdeps -plinux-linaro-tools-2.6.35-1006
dh_shlibdeps: package linux-linaro-tools-2.6.35-1006 is not in control info
dh_installdeb -plinux-linaro-tools-2.6.35-1006
dh_installdeb: package linux-linaro-tools-2.6.35-1006 is not in control info
dh_installdeb: package linux-linaro-tools-2.6.35-1006 is not in control info
dh_gencontrol -plinux-linaro-tools-2.6.35-1006
dpkg-gencontrol: error: package linux-linaro-tools-2.6.35-1006 not in control info
dh_gencontrol: dpkg-gencontrol -plinux-linaro-tools-2.6.35-1006 -ldebian/changelog -Tdebian/linux-linaro-tools-2.6.35-1006.substvars -Pdebian/linux-linaro-tools-2.6.35-1006 returned exit code 255
make: *** [binary-perarch] Error 9
dpkg-buildpackage: error: /usr/bin/fakeroot debian/rules binary-arch gave error exit status 2
******************************************************************************
Build finished at 20100918-1727
FAILED [dpkg-buildpackage died]
Purging chroot-autobuild/build/buildd/linux-linaro-2.6.35
------------------------------------------------------------------------------
  /usr/bin/sudo dpkg --purge intltool-debian groff-base libdw-dev gettext file libdw1 libelf-dev rsync html2text gettext-base libelf1 debhelper po-debconf libunistring0 libcroco3 libmagic1 libxml2 libpopt0 kernel-wedge bsdmainutils binutils-dev man-db
(Reading database ... 14669 files and directories currently installed.)
Removing libdw-dev ...
Removing libdw1 ...
Purging configuration files for libdw1 ...
Removing libelf-dev ...
Removing rsync ...
Purging configuration files for rsync ...
Removing libelf1 ...
Purging configuration files for libelf1 ...
Removing libpopt0 ...
Purging configuration files for libpopt0 ...
Removing kernel-wedge ...
Removing binutils-dev ...
Removing debhelper ...
Removing po-debconf ...
Removing man-db ...
Purging configuration files for man-db ...
  Removing catpages as well as /var/cache/man hierarchy.
Removing intltool-debian ...
Removing groff-base ...
Purging configuration files for groff-base ...
Removing gettext ...
Removing file ...
Purging configuration files for file ...
Removing html2text ...
Purging configuration files for html2text ...
Removing gettext-base ...
Removing libunistring0 ...
Purging configuration files for libunistring0 ...
Removing libcroco3 ...
Purging configuration files for libcroco3 ...
Removing libmagic1 ...
Purging configuration files for libmagic1 ...
Removing libxml2 ...
Purging configuration files for libxml2 ...
Removing bsdmainutils ...
Purging configuration files for bsdmainutils ...
Processing triggers for libc-bin ...
ldconfig deferred processing now taking place
******************************************************************************
Finished at 20100918-1731
Build needed 09:21:10, 4316836k disk space
RUN: /usr/share/launchpad-buildd/slavebin/scan-for-processes ['/usr/share/launchpad-buildd/slavebin/scan-for-processes', 'd84ad11f6b2830795eaab901d128fa7b845f9596']
Scanning for processes to kill in build /home/buildd/build-d84ad11f6b2830795eaab901d128fa7b845f9596/chroot-autobuild...
RUN: /usr/share/launchpad-buildd/slavebin/umount-chroot ['umount-chroot', 'd84ad11f6b2830795eaab901d128fa7b845f9596']
Unmounting chroot for build d84ad11f6b2830795eaab901d128fa7b845f9596...
RUN: /usr/share/launchpad-buildd/slavebin/remove-build ['remove-build', 'd84ad11f6b2830795eaab901d128fa7b845f9596']
Removing build d84ad11f6b2830795eaab901d128fa7b845f9596

Revision history for this message
Jamie Bennett (jamiebennett) wrote :

Setting to high as no images cannot be built until this is fixed.

Changed in linux-linaro (Ubuntu):
assignee: nobody → John Rigby (jcrigby)
importance: Undecided → High
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package linux-linaro - 2.6.35-1006.12

---------------
linux-linaro (2.6.35-1006.12) maverick; urgency=low

  [ John Rigby ]

  * Revert "LINARO: [Config] workaround for kernel-wedge error on empty
    udebs"
  * LINARO: Start new release
  * LINARO: no mouse-modules for linaro-vexpress
  * LINARO: Add tools section to debian.linaro/control.stub.in
    - LP: #643462
 -- John Rigby <email address hidden> Mon, 20 Sep 2010 10:20:21 -0600

Changed in linux-linaro (Ubuntu):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.